芯步智能语音音柱提供开放的HTTP接口,支持通过文本推送直接触发语音播报,无需预录音频,这恰好解决了养老社区“通知多、更新快、操作人员不固定”的痛点。以下方案聚焦如何用极简接口实现播放列表的远程管理。
1. 背景与需求分析
在养老社区运营中,语音通知是传递信息、组织活动、紧急疏散的核心手段。传统广播系统依赖人工现场操作或定时的SD卡播放,存在以下痛点:
时效性差:临时通知(如“3号楼王爷爷家属到访”)需现场喊话,或依赖复杂操作。
管理僵化:播放列表通常固化在设备本地,修改晨操音乐、午休提醒时间需要现场拔卡更换文件。
集成度低:无法与现有的养老管理系统(如SOS呼叫、护理派单)联动。
针对上述痛点,芯步智能语音音柱因其开放HTTP接口和实时TTS(文字转语音)能力,成为了理想的解决方案核心。
2. 核心产品与接口能力
本方案选用芯步 “智能语音音柱系列” 产品(如Pro60W或智能语音喇叭2)。
核心接口能力
实时播报(TTS):通过
play:gbk:16命令,直接推送文本,设备立即发声。设备控制:支持远程调节音量、音色(男/女)、语速。
状态双向同步:设备上下线、播放状态可推送到服务器。
网络适应性:支持WiFi 2.4G/有线网络,甚至支持纯局域网私有化部署,保障社区数据安全。
3. 总体技术架构
针对“远程播放列表管理”,架构采用“中心化管理,边缘节点执行”的模式,避免对现有网络的大规模改造。
管理层(云/本地服务器):部署“养老社区语音中控服务”,该服务包含播放列表编排引擎。
执行层(芯步硬件):分布于各楼层、食堂、活动室的智能音柱。
接入层(标准API):管理平台通过调用芯步开放平台的 HTTP API 下发指令。
4. 播放列表管理核心方案设计
该方案的核心在于:硬件本身不存储复杂列表,列表由云端(或本地服务器)管理,仅下发具体的“播放指令”。
4.1 列表的“逻辑”存储与转译
数据隔离:在后端数据库为每个音柱(设备ID)建立独立的时间表或任务队列。
智能分发
定时任务:如每天早上8:00,服务器自动向指定设备ID下发
{"order":{"play:gbk:16":"现在是早上8点,请长者到餐厅用餐,今天的早餐有小米粥和鸡蛋。"}}。循环任务:利用服务器端的
repeat参数或由服务端发起轮询,无需在硬件端设置循环。
4.2 动态内容渲染(变量替换)
养老通知常有变动信息(如“今天下午的书法课在2楼会议室”)。本方案利用服务器编程能力,拼接动态字符串。例如:“今日菜单”接口返回数据 -> 中控服务自动封装为 -> {"order":{"play:gbk:16":"各位长者好,今日午餐推荐菜品:清蒸鲈鱼。"}}。
4.3 优先级与打断机制
在养老场景中,紧急通知(如SOS呼救联动)必须打断常规播报(如背景音乐)。
策略:管理层维护一个命令队列。当接收到高优先级指令(如“5栋烟感报警”)时,服务端立即调用
{"order":{"stop":1}}接口停止当前播报,随后立即下发高优先级TTS内容。
5. 典型场景实施路径
5.1 第一种场景:每日定时活动提醒(环境音乐与通知)
需求:周一至周五上午9:30播放健身操音乐和指令。实施
后端配置:在管理后台设定定时Cron Job。
执行动作:时间触发后,后端请求芯步API:
https://api.thingboot.com/{AppId}/device/control/...,Body为{"device":["YZ001"],"order":{"play:gbk:16":"现在是健身操时间,请各位长者前往多功能厅,跟着音乐一起运动。"}}。扩展:如果是纯音乐,可使用内置铃声或MP3流地址(如支持)。
5.2 第二种场景:访客与零散通知(“找人”场景)
需求:302房间李奶奶家属来访,前台需通知其回房间。实施
前端操作:前台在PC/Web端搜索“李奶奶” -> 点击“语音通知” -> 输入“李奶奶,您的家属在前台等候”。
API调用:系统通过接口不仅向公共区域广播,也可精准向“3楼走廊”或“李奶奶房内呼叫器”(如配有语音喇叭3)下发指令。
效果:无需前台跑上跑下,实现静默、温馨的通知。
5.3 第三种场景:环境感知联动(智能传感器对接)
需求:洗手间长时间无人响应或发生跌倒报警时,后台确认后需现场喊话安抚。实施
联动:接入芯步的“人体存在传感器”。当传感器上报“长时间无人/有人倒地”事件至服务器。
动作:服务器自动触发语音指令
{"order":{"play:gbk:16":"现场的长者请不要慌张,医护人员马上到达,请保持原地不动。"}}。价值:在工作人员到达前给予长者心理安抚,并通过语音确认现场情况。
5.4 场景四:列表的远程修改(无需现场维护)
需求:因季节变化,调整熄灯前的温馨提示内容(从“注意保暖”改为“注意防暑”)。实施运营人员在管理后台修改“晚安语”文本框 -> 点击保存。系统自动将新文本通过API推送给音柱试听,无需任何人前往设备所在位置操作。
6. 方案实施关键步骤
环境准备
采购芯步智能语音音柱(Pro 60W用于大厅/室外,Mini/86型用于室内/走廊)。
确保设备已通过WiFi/网线接入社区局域网或互联网,并获取设备ID。
接口调试
在芯步开放平台获取
AppId和AppSecret,参考签名算法md5(md5(AppSecret) + ts)生成动态sign。使用Postman测试单次播报:
POST /{AppId}/device/control/with{"device":"test_id","order":{"play:gbk:16":"Hello World"}}。
中控服务开发
开发简易管理后台,包含:设备管理(录入Device ID)、模板管理(存储常用通知文本)、排程管理(日历化设置播放时间)、日志审计(记录每次播报历史)。
业务融合
如果社区已有管理系统,直接调用中控服务API,实现“一键喊话”按钮嵌入现有SaaS平台。
7. 总结
| 维度 | 传统解决方案 | 本方案(芯步) |
|---|---|---|
| 更新速度 | 慢(需现场SD卡拔插) | 快(秒级,云端下发即可) |
| 内容灵活性 | 固定MP3文件 | 实时TTS合成,支持变量替换 |
| 系统集成度 | 封闭,无法获取状态 | API全开放,可与SOS/门禁联动 |
| 场景适应性 | 大范围广播,扰民 | 精准分区,可只推送到特定设备 |
| 运维成本 | 专人现场维护 | 零现场维护,远程排查与配置 |
通过该方案,养老社区可构建一个“会说话的物联网”,提升长者满意度和运营响应速度。